Example: Create Custom Navigation Group

Example: Create Custom Navigation Group

This example illustrates how to create a custom navigation group within a hub to centralize access for related dashboards.
To improve organization and provide a centralized access point within the
Project Manager Hub
, you want to group together managers' frequently used dashboards. This group will contain an existing
Workday-delivered
dashboard alongside newly added
Custom Project
dashboard, ensuring managers can find both easily in one centralized location in the hub.
Security: Set Up: Tenant Setup - Hub
domain in the System functional area.
